Specifications
| Spec | Radeon RX 6650 XT | Radeon RX 7600 |
|---|---|---|
| VRAM | 8GB GDDR6 | 8GB GDDR6 |
| Memory Bandwidth | 280 GB/s | 288 GB/s |
| Shaders | 2048 | 2048 |
| Boost Clock | 2635 MHz | 2655 MHz |
| TDP | 176W | 165W |
| Architecture | RDNA 2.0 | RDNA 3.0 |
| 3DMark Steel Nomad | 1,854 | 2,312 |
| Best Price | $399 | $269 |
| Value Score | 41/100 | 64/100 |

AMD Radeon RX 6650 XT vs AMD Radeon RX 7600: Which Should You Buy?
These two land on top of each other: 57.3 fps versus 54.5 fps at 1440p ultra, a 5% difference you will not notice in a game. The decision comes down to price, VRAM and power draw rather than speed.
Pricing settles it: the AMD Radeon RX 7600 is both faster and 48% cheaper at $269 versus $399. There is no scenario in this pairing where the AMD Radeon RX 6650 XT is the better buy at these prices.
